Once again the meeting is being organized by the MG Car Club of Tasmania.  Baskerville Race Circuit is located only 20 minutes from Hobart . Having Celebrated its 50th Anniversary in February 2008 it is the oldest continuously operating circuit in Australia. Being a tight 7-Turn 2 klm circuit designed in the fifties for cars of the era it is ideally suited to classic motor sport. 

Classes

Races will be open to all 5th Category log booked vehicles except Group A & C Touring Cars. Cars complying with Groups J,L,N, and S are eligible for Regularity. Other cars may be included at the discretion of the Organizers and the local historic commissioner. There will also be MG Only races open to any log booked MG racing car.

A Little bit about Hobart

Hobart, Tasmania’s harbourside capital city, is set on the shores of the River Derwent, with the blue bulk of Mt Wellington as a backdrop.

Hobart is a city of sails and sandstone, festivals and flavours – colourful spinnakers on the harbour, fine old 19th century warehouses along Salamanca Place, the fun and music of the waterfront Summer Festival and excellent restaurants highlighting Tasmania’s fine fresh produce.

From Hobart, it’s an easy day tour to the wineries of the Southern Wine Route, to tall forests and national parks or to the nation’s most significant historic site, Port Arthur.
